2nd district helping out during holidays

Capt. Marc Metellus and community relations officer Mark Mroz spoke at last week’s 2nd Police District Advisory Council meeting.

Mroz thanked Bill Conaway, director of community relations at the Philadelphia Protestant Home, for organizing a Veterans Day luncheon. PPH is home to more than 60 veterans, including three centenarians.

The 2nd district will be involved in a number of upcoming events and initiatives, starting with providing Operations Thanksgiving food baskets for the needy.

Mroz will be the DJ at the annual Fox Chase Champions party for special needs children and young adults at Knowlton Mansion on Dec. 12.

The citywide Shop with a Cop will take place on Dec. 15 at the Walmart in South Philadelphia. Each police district brings 10 local children to shop during the holiday season with a Walmart gift card.

The Santa Ride is back on Saturday, Dec. 16. Santa and Mrs. Claus, joined by elves and Mickey and Minnie Mouse, will ride in a truck through the streets of Fox Chase, starting at 4 p.m., tossing candy canes to kids. Track the Santa Ride on the Fox Chase Lock & Key page on Facebook.

On the crime front, the armed robber shot to death by an employee of a Northwood pizza shop on Nov. 4 was a suspect in a recent robbery of Castor Pizza.

In other news from the Nov. 14 meeting:

• PennDOT will hold a meeting on safety improvements to Castor Avenue on Monday, Nov. 27, from 4-7 p.m. at Northeast Services Hub, 6434 Castor Ave. The improvements will come on Castor, from Oxford Circle to Cottman Avenue. Plans are to add parking-protected bike lanes and convert the avenue from four lanes to three, with center-left turn lanes at major intersections.

• The Rockledge Fox Chase Business Association will sponsor a tree-lighting ceremony on Saturday, Dec. 2, from 2-5 p.m. at Northeast Lions Park, 7964 Oxford Ave. There will be face painting, crafters/vendors, hot chocolate, cookies, ornament making, holiday music, singing with Leslie, Joe and Jeff and an appearance by Santa Claus, who’ll arrive on a Rockledge Volunteer Fire Company truck.

• The Energy Coordinating Agency will hold a LIHEAP and utility services application event on Saturday, Dec. 2, from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. at Northeast Services Hub, 6434 Castor Ave.

• State Rep. Jared Solomon last Friday opened a new office at 7104 Frankford Ave.

• The 2nd PDAC will meet at 6 p.m. at the Protestant Home, 6401 Martins Mill Road, on Tuesdays, Dec. 12, Jan. 9, Feb. 13, March 12, April 9, May 14 and June 11. ••
